What they do

A Civil or Architectural Designer or Drafter prepares detailed drawings for building plans and architectural designs. Creates drawings according to specifications provided by an architect, and uses computer-aided design and drafting technology.

$65,318 / year median in Illinois

+6% projected growth

Job Description

Company Overview GSG Consultants, Inc. (GSG) is a multidisciplinary professional engineering firm providing planning, design, construction, and program management services to state, county, municipal, transportation, and private-sector clients throughout the Midwest. With more than 150 technical professionals, GSG delivers innovative infrastructure solutions that improve communities and enhance mobility. GSG is committed to excellence, collaboration, and professional development and is proud to be an Equal Opportunity Employer. Why Join GSG? At GSG, you'll have the opportunity to lead impactful infrastructure projects, mentor talented professionals, and contribute to the growth of a respected engineering organization. We offer a collaborative work environment, challenging projects, and outstanding opportunities for professional advancement. Position Summary GSG is seeking an experienced and motivated Civil / Transportation Design Manager to lead our Design Group. This leadership position is responsible for overseeing transportation, utility, and site development design projects; managing engineering staff; ensuring technical excellence; and supporting business growth initiatives. The successful candidate will serve as both a technical leader and client relationship manager while delivering high-quality engineering solutions to public and private sector clients. Key Responsibilities Lead, mentor, and manage a multidisciplinary team of engineers, technicians, project managers, and design professionals. Oversee the planning, design, and delivery of transportation, utility, and site development projects. Develop and maintain strong relationships with clients, agencies, and key stakeholders. Manage project budgets, schedules, staffing, and resource allocation to ensure successful project delivery. Collaborate with company leadership and technical staff across multiple disciplines to support strategic growth initiatives. Direct the preparation and review of engineering plans, specifications, cost estimates, studies, and technical reports. Ensure compliance with client requirements, applicable codes, standards, and regulatory requirements. Establish and enforce Quality Assurance/Quality Control (QA/QC) procedures for all projects. Support business development activities, including proposal preparation, client presentations, and project pursuits. Promote a positive team culture focused on technical excellence, innovation, and professional growth. Qualifications Required Bachelor's Degree in Civil Engineering from an ABET-accredited program. Illinois Professional Engineer (P.E.) license. Minimum of 15 years of progressive experience in transportation engineering and design. Demonstrated experience managing transportation projects for agencies such as IDOT, CDOT, Illinois Tollway, transit agencies, rail agencies, or municipal clients. Proven experience leading and supervising multidisciplinary engineering teams. Strong understanding of project management principles, including budgeting, scheduling, and resource management. Excellent communication, leadership, and interpersonal skills. Ability to manage multiple projects and priorities simultaneously while maintaining high-quality deliverables. Pro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ite. Working knowledge of Bentley MicroStation, OpenRoads Designer (ORD), and CONNECT Edition applications. Preferred Experience serving as Project Manager or Design Manager on large transportation infrastructure projects. Existing relationships with transportation agencies and municipal clients throughout Illinois and the Midwest.
